Nevada requires how many hours of pre-license education?

2:23
0 views

Question & Answer

Review the question and all answer choices

A

60 hours

60 hours is insufficient for Nevada licensure requirements. This might be confused with continuing education hours or requirements in other states like Arizona.

B

90 hours

Correct Answer
C

120 hours

120 hours exceeds Nevada's requirement. This might be confused with broker licensure requirements in some states or combined continuing education hours.

D

150 hours

150 hours significantly exceeds Nevada's salesperson requirement and may be closer to broker requirements in some states.

Why is this correct?

Nevada Administrative Code 645.550 specifically mandates 90 hours of pre-licensure education for salesperson licensure, typically divided into three 30-hour courses covering principles, practices, and law.
